So we live near the apple orchards and that bring with it bugs. Fruit flies to be exact! Never did I consider this a by-product of where we live, but we have developed a way to kill them that is non-toxic to the cats. Apple cider vinegar in a bowl - you put saran wrap over the top and poke a few holes and magically they are dumb enough to get trapped or maybe drunk enough to not care? They are everywhere. The kitchen of course, the bedroom, the bathrooms and probably the basement! argh! Can't wait for a frost to snap them off!
